html,body {
	margin: 0;
	padding: 0;
	background-color:white;
}

table {
	width: 100%;
	height: 100%;
}

td {
	vertical-align: middle;
	text-align: center;
}

img {
	border: 0px;
}

div {
	border: 1px solid #969696;
}

div.container {
	border: 0px;
	position: relative;
	text-align: left;
	margin-left: auto;
	margin-right: auto;
	width: 700px;
	height: 100%;
}

div.header {
	border: 0px;
	position: absolute;
	top: 25px;
	left: 000px;
	width: 700px;
	height: 129px;
}

div.topleft{
	border: 0px;
	position: absolute;
	top: 000px;
	left: 000px;
	width: 50px;
	height: 25px;
	background-image:url('../images/top-left.gif');
}

div.topmiddle{
	position: absolute;
	top: 000px;
	left: 52px;
	width: 596px;
	height: 23px;
	background-color:#e3e3e3;
	text-align:right;
}

.logotext{
	font-weight: bold;
	font-size: 20px;
	color: #262626;
	font-style: normal;
	font-family: Courier, Courier New, monospace;
	font-variant: normal;
	text-decoration: none;
	text-align:right;
	vertical-align:middle;
	margin-right:10px;
}

a.logotext{
	font-weight: bold;
	font-size: 20px;
	color: #262626;
	font-style: normal;
	font-family: Courier, Courier New, monospace;
	font-variant: normal;
	text-decoration: none;
	text-align:right;
	vertical-align:middle;
	margin-right:10px; 
}

a.logotext:hover{
	color: #ff5900;
text-decoration: underline;
}

div.topright{
	position: absolute;
	top: 000px;
	left: 652px;
	width: 48px;
	height: 23px;
	background-color:#e3e3e3;
}

div.middleleft{
	position: absolute;
	top: 27px;
	left: 000px;
	width: 48px;
	height: 23px;
	background-color:#f2f2f2;
}

div.middleright{
	position: absolute;
	top: 27px;
	left: 652px;
	width: 48px;
	height: 23px;
	background-color:#f2f2f2;
}

div.bottomleft{
	position: absolute;
	top: 54px;
	left: 000px;
	width: 48px;
	height: 23px;
	background-color:#ffffff;
}

div.bottomright{
	border: 0px;
	position: absolute;
	top: 54px;
	left: 652px;
	width: 50px;
	height: 25px;
	background-image:url('../images/bottom-right-new.gif');
}

div.menubanner{
	position: absolute;
	top: 27px;
	left: 52px;
	width: 596px;
	height: 50px;
}

div.menucol1{
	border:0px;
	position: absolute;
	top: 16px;
	left: 0px;
	width: 99px;
	height: 16px;
	text-align:center;
}

div.menucol2{
	border:0px;
	position: absolute;
	top: 16px;
	left: 99px;
	width: 119px;
	height: 16px;
	text-align:center;
}

div.menucol3{
	border:0px;
	position: absolute;
	top: 16px;
	left: 218px;
	width: 119px;
	height: 16px;
	text-align:center;
}

div.menucol4{
	border:0px;
	position: absolute;
	top: 16px;
	left: 337px;
	width: 119px;
	height: 16px;
	text-align:center;
}

div.menucol5{
	border:0px;
	position: absolute;
	top: 16px;
	left: 456px;
	width: 140px;
	height: 16px;
	text-align:center;
}

.menutitle{
	text-align:left;
	font-family: Arial, Verdana, Helvetica, sans-serif;
	font-weight: bold;
	font-size: 16px;
	color: #262626;
}

a.menutitle{
	text-align:left;
	font-family: Arial, Verdana, Helvetica, sans-serif;
	font-weight: normal;
	font-size: 16px;
	color: #262626;
	font-style: normal;
	font-variant: normal;
	text-decoration: none;
}

a.menutitle:hover{
	color: #ff5900;
}

a.menutitleselected{
	text-align:left;
	font-family: Arial, Verdana, Helvetica, sans-serif;
	font-weight: bold;
	font-size: 16px;
	font-style: normal;
	font-variant: normal;
	text-decoration: none;
	color: #262626;
}

.spacer{
	font-family: Arial, Verdana, Helvetica, sans-serif;
	font-size: 3px;
}

a.menutext{
	text-align:left;
	font-family: Arial, Verdana, Helvetica, sans-serif;
	font-weight: normal;
	font-size: 13px;
	color: #676767;
	font-style: normal;
	font-variant: normal;
	text-decoration:none;
}

a.menutext:hover{
	color: #ff5900;
}

a.menutextselected{
	text-align:left;
	font-family: Arial, Verdana, Helvetica, sans-serif;
	font-weight: bold;
	font-size: 13px;
	font-style: normal;
	font-variant: normal;
	text-decoration: none;
	color: #ff5900;
}

.menutextselected{
	text-align:left;
	font-family: Arial, Verdana, Helvetica, sans-serif;
	font-weight: bold;
	font-size: 13px;
	font-style: normal;
	font-variant: normal;
	text-decoration: none;
	color: #ff5900;
}

div.main {
	border: 0px;
	position: absolute;
	top: 124px;
	left: 000px;
	width: 700px;
	height: 388px;
	z-index:0;
}

div.maintitleleft{
	border: 0px;
	position: absolute;
	top: 0px;
	left: 000px;
	width: 25px;
	height: 25px;
	background-image:url('../images/top-left-no-right-border.gif');
	z-index:1;
}

div.maintitleright{
	border-left: 0px;
	position: absolute;
	top: 0px;
	left: 25px;
	width: 676px;
	height: 23px;
	background-color:#e3e3e3;
	vertical-align:middle;
}

div.titleheading{
	border:0px;
	position: absolute;
	top:3px;
	left:0px;
	height: 23px;
	text-align:left;
	font-family: Arial, Verdana, Helvetica, sans-serif;
	font-weight: bold;
	font-size: 14px;
	color: #262626;
}

a.titlelink{
	height: 23px;
	text-align:left;
	font-family: Arial, Verdana, Helvetica, sans-serif;
	font-weight: normal;
	font-size: 14px;
	color: #262626;
	text-decoration: none;
}

a.titlelink:hover{
	color: #ff5900;
}

div.titlenav{
	border:0px;
	position: absolute;
	top:4px;
	right:10px;
	height: 25px;
}

a.titlenav{
	font-family: Arial, Verdana, Helvetica, sans-serif;
	font-weight: bold;
	font-size: 12px;
	color: #676767;
	font-style: normal;
	font-variant: normal;
	text-decoration: none;
}

a.titlenav:hover{
	color: #ff5900;
}

.summaryheading {
	text-align:left;
	font-family: Arial, Verdana, Helvetica, sans-serif;
	font-weight: bold;
	font-size: 12px;
	color: #262626;
}

.summarytext {
	text-align:left;
	font-family: Arial, Verdana, Helvetica, sans-serif;
	font-weight: normal;
	font-size: 12px;
	color: #676767;
}

.summarytextstrong {
	text-align:left;
	font-family: Arial, Verdana, Helvetica, sans-serif;
	font-weight: normal;
	font-size: 12px;
	color: #010101;
}

.summarytextunderline {
	text-align:left;
	font-family: Arial, Verdana, Helvetica, sans-serif;
	font-weight: normal;
	text-decoration: underline;
	font-size: 12px;
	color: #676767;
}

a.emaillink {
	text-align:left;
	font-family: Arial, Verdana, Helvetica, sans-serif;
	font-weight: normal;
	font-size: 12px;
	color: #676767;
	text-decoration: underline;
}

a.emaillink:hover {
	color: #ff5900;
}

.cogleaptext {
	text-align:left;
	font-family: Courier, Courier New, monospace;
	font-weight: normal;
	font-size: 15px;
	color: #262626;
}

a.summarytext{
	text-align:left;
	font-family: Arial, Verdana, Helvetica, sans-serif;
	font-weight: normal;
	font-size: 12px;
	color: #010101;
	font-style: normal;
	font-variant: normal;
	text-decoration: none;
}

a.summarytext:hover{
	color: #ff5900;
}

a.summaryall{
	font-style: normal;
	font-variant: normal;
	text-decoration: none;
}

div.footer {
	border:0px;
	position: absolute;
	top: 588px;
	left: 000px;
	width: 700px;
	height: 10px;
}

div.footercount{
	visibilty:hidden;
	display:none;
	border:0px;
	position: absolute;
	top: 5px;
	left: 0px;
	font-weight: normal;
	font-size: 12px;
	color: #262626;
	font-style: normal;
	font-family: Courier, Courier New, monospace;
	font-variant: normal;
	text-decoration: none;
	text-align:left;
}

div.footertag{
	border:0px;
	position: absolute;
	top: 5px;
	right: 20px;
	font-weight: normal;
	font-size: 12px;
	color: #262626;
	font-style: normal;
	font-family: Courier, Courier New, monospace;
	font-variant: normal;
	text-decoration: none;
	text-align:right;
}

a.footertag{
	font-weight: normal;
	font-size: 12px;
	color: #262626;
	font-style: normal;
	font-family: Courier, Courier New, monospace;
	font-variant: normal;
	text-decoration: none;
	text-align:right;
}

a.footertag:hover{
	color: #ff5900;
}

.error{
	color:red
}


